EPA warns on air quality: Insanity that will cost us all dearly
In its latest report, the agency deals with air quality — an issue at the root of an estimated 1,510 premature deaths in 2014.
The EPA warns that burning solid fuels for home heating is the primary way we pollute air we breathe. Emissions from vehicles were the second biggest threat.
